Features
Description
The L5957 contains a triple voltage regulator and
a power switch.
Table 1.
January 2010
Four outputs:
– 8.5 V @ 500 mA
– 5 V @ 300 mA Permanent
– 5 V @ 800 mA
– 3.3 V @ 800 mA
2 A high side driver
Reset function
Ignition comparator
Load dump protection
Thermal shutdown
Overcurrent limitation
All pins ESD protected
